* **Optimized Incremental Calculation:**
|
||||
Unlike basic implementations that recalculate the entire history on every tick, this indicator employs an intelligent incremental algorithm.
|
||||
* It utilizes the `prev_calculated` state to determine the exact starting point for updates.
|
||||
* **Persistent State:** The internal buffers for the Homodyne Discriminator (`m_I1_buf`, `m_Q1_buf`, etc.) and the phase measurement persist their state between ticks. This allows the complex DSP pipeline to continue seamlessly from the last known values without re-processing the entire history.
|
||||
* This results in **O(1) complexity** per tick, ensuring instant updates and zero lag, even on charts with extensive history.
